Aims of the course unit: | ||||
The goal is to familiarize students with theoretical requirements and learn how to use standard air phraseology for VFR flights level with extension of IFR flights. | ||||
Learning outcomes and competences: | ||||
Students will learn to use air phraseology. | ||||
Prerequisites: | ||||
No special requirements. | ||||
Course contents: | ||||
Standard air phraseology used in aircraft, air communication regulations, based on the regulations of the ICAO standards. | ||||
Teaching methods and criteria: | ||||
The course is taught through lectures explaining the basic principles and theory of the discipline. Exercises are focused on practical topics presented in lectures. | ||||
Assesment methods and criteria linked to learning outcomes: | ||||
The exam is of written (essential) and oral form. | ||||

Course curriculum: | ||||
Lecture | 1. Definitions. Air Traffic Control abbreviations. 2. Q-code groups commonly used in R/T air ground communications. Categories of messages. 3. Transmission of letters. Transmission of numbers. Transmission of time. Transmission technique. 4. Standard words and phrases (relevant R/T). Radiotelephony call sign for aeronautical (ground) stations including use of abbreviated call signs. Radiotelephony call sign for aircraft including use of abbreviated call signs. 5. Transfer of communication. Test procedures including readability scale. Read back and acknowledgement requirements. 6. Radar procedural phraseology I. 7. Radar procedural phraseology II. 8. Radar procedural phraseology III. 9. SELCAL, TCAS, ACARS phraseology and procedures. 10. Relevant weather information terms. 11. Action to be taken in case of communication failure. 12. Distress and urgency procedures. 13. General principles of VHF propagation and allocation of frequencies. |
